Recent findings from a United Nations committee reveal that women with disabilities still suffer from coerced abortions and sterilisation in parts of Europe. Christian advocates stress the moral imperative for nations to defend every individual’s God-given value, especially the most vulnerable.

UN Committee leader Markus Schefer stated,

“Forced sterilisation and forced abortions were still being perpetrated on women with disabilities in European Union Member States.”

He noted the lack of criminalization and policy response addressing these abuses. The EU responded with plans for a women’s rights roadmap to combat such harmful practices.

Lord David Alton, a committed Christian voice for human rights, described these actions as “an appalling crime and a stain upon those EU Member States that fail to criminalise or otherwise suppress such actions.”

He urged nations to recognize their special responsibility to protect people with disabilities and cited a 2019 UK case where a learning-disabled woman faced a forced abortion before the ruling was overturned.

Alton further emphasized,

“We must take action to address the shortage of protective measures against forced abortions and forced sterilisations.”

He encouraged the EU to fully enforce its existing agreements, supporting women to continue pregnancies without coercion.

Catherine Robinson of Right To Life UK called forced abortion and sterilisation “a grave injustice” that has no place in any nation. She challenged leaders across Europe to act decisively, ensuring robust laws shield vulnerable women, guided by Biblical principles of life and justice.
